Thai Airways Fleet Expansion On Hold
A $2.7 billion fleet expansion for Thai Airways International has been placed in jeopardy, as the Thai government is forcing the carrier to reconsider or delay its acquisition of 21 Boeing and Airbus aircraft, the airline said.
